Mark Teixiera (wrist) said Tuesday that he expects to be back with the Yankees by June 1.
Teixiera previously set May 1 as a goal, but he wasn't able to hit as quickly as he first expected. However, he has made solid progress over the past few weeks and said Tuesday that his rehab is "going great." It's not clear when he'll be ready for a minor league rehab assignment, but he's getting closer.

Yankees transferred 1B Mark Teixeira from the 15-day disabled list to the 60-day disabled list.
The move was made in order to clear room on the 40-man roster for Alberto Gonzalez. Teixeira won't be back from his wrist injury until sometime next month.

Mark Teixeira (wrist) is expected to take live batting practice on the field Sunday.
It will be the first time he's done so since suffering a torn tendon sheath in his right wrist. Teixeira hit soft toss and off a tee for the third straight day on Friday and is ready to test out the wrist further. After Sunday's BP, he'll report to the Yankees' spring training complex to continue his rehab. "I feel like I got over the hump with the last few, hitting soft toss," Teixeira said. "It's been really, really good to kind of let it go, and feel the ball off the bat."

Mark Teixeira (wrist) took batting practice in the cages at Yankee Stadium on Wednesday.
Teixeira had been limited to dry swings only, so this is a notable step. It's unclear when he'll be ready to test out his wrist in batting practice on the field and the nin rehab games. Yankees manager Joe Girardi has expressed doubt that his first baseman will make it back before the end of May.

Andrew Marchand of ESPNNewYork.com reports that a return in late May for Mark Teixeira (wrist) is the "best case," but June "seems more likely."
Teixeira is currently limited to dry swings, and it's uncertain when he'll be cleared to hit off a tee or take soft tosses. Ultimately, his status will continue to be cloudy until we see how his wrist responds to increased activity. There's also no guarantee that Teixeira will be able to avoid surgery over the long haul.

Mark Teixeira (wrist) acknowledged Tuesday that he will not be ready by May 1.
Teixeira initially aimed to be ready by May 1, but his wrist isn't loose enough for him to begin hitting, so he's finally ready to admit the obvious. "Obviously, I was being as optimistic as I could," said Teixeira. "I wish that the very first time I swung a bat, I'd be like, 'Wow, I feel 100 percent.' But the chances of that happening weren't there, but I was always going to hope for that and prepare for that." Teixeira was initially expected to miss 8-10 weeks, which places his return in mid-May. However, his timeline depends on how his wrist responds to increased activity, it's hard to predict when he'll be ready.

Mark Teixeira (wrist) took swings underwater on Tuesday.
It's a way to ease him back into baseball activities following a partially torn tendon sheath in his right wrist. Things went well, as he's slated to progress to dry swings on Wednesday. According to MLB.com's Bryan Hoch, Teixeira hopes to take batting practice in Toronto and work out in Tampa next week. His goal of returning by May 1 may be overly optimistic, but he's beginning to make significant progress.

Mark Teixeira (wrist) wasn't cleared to begin swinging a bat Friday as originally hoped.
Teixeira's latest timetable has him returning in early May, but it's sounds like this is at least a minor setback. Considering he's yet to play in a game this season, Teixeira will likely need a lengthy rehab assignment so he still has a lot of hurdles to cross in order to meet his optimistic goal. The Yankees will continue to go with Lyle Overbay and Kevin Youkilis in his absence.
